Join us as our Defence & Security Virtual Practice Leader, based in London and supporting UK and global outward business. This is a unique opportunity for a commercially minded leader to unite stakeholders behind a clear vision and turn strategy into measurable growth.

We are seeking an exceptional leader to establish and grow a UK Defence & Security Virtual Practice. With an established portfolio of clients across multiple teams from which you can derive specialist expertise, the opportunity is to unite existing strengths, create a distinctive market-facing proposition and accelerate growth across government, defence, aerospace, security, technology and critical infrastructure organisations. The role combines sector leadership, business development, client engagement with the potential to assume P&L responsibility as the practice scales.

Working across the UK and our global network, you will coordinate teams and specialist expertise around shared priorities, embed new ways of working and lead from the front on priority opportunities. You will develop differentiated solutions that help clients navigate an increasingly complex geopolitical, operational and risk landscape.

The Role

As lead, you will set the strategy and operating model for a new virtual practice. Success will require visible leadership, business growth momentum and broad stakeholder commitment. You will:

  • Map Defence & Security clients, opportunities and activity across the organisation, establishing clear priorities and aligned account plans.
  • Drive adoption of the new practice model by securing stakeholder commitment and embedding consistent ways of working.
  • Build and strengthen relationships with senior stakeholders across defence, government, security, aerospace and related industries.
  • Identify emerging market trends, risks and opportunities and convert insight into commercial action.
  • Personally lead major business development opportunities and complex client engagements, mobilising the right expertise at the right time.
  • Create innovative client propositions by bringing together expertise across risk, insurance, advisory, analytics and capital solutions.
  • Act as an executive sponsor for key strategic accounts and support long-term client retention and growth.
  • Represent the organisation externally through industry events, thought leadership and professional networks.
  • Collaborate with global sector leaders to ensure alignment between UK priorities and international strategy.
  • Implement the governance, talent plan and commercial structure required to scale the practice.

How to prepare for a job interview at WTW

Master the Case Study Game

In management consulting, case study interviews are all the rage. Make sure to practice structuring your thoughts and analysing data on the fly. Use resources like example case studies to get comfortable with frameworks and solutions. Remember, it’s not just about getting the right answer but showcasing your thought process, so talk us through your reasoning!

Know Your Numbers

Be prepared for some numerical and analytical questions. Brush up on your mental math and be ready to interpret data from charts or graphs. We might throw some business scenarios at you that require a quick turnaround on numerical analysis, so practice these skills to feel confident and swift!
